The grand unified rating list May 2012

Post by Vinvin »

Time control is about 30 sec to 2 min per moves on an AMD 2 Ghz.

Games from CEGT, CCRL, WBEC, SWCR and Chess War.
1'321'245 games.

Don't forget to look at the error bar (+ and -) !
- If there's no "n-CPU" info, it's 1 CPU.
- If there's no "n-bit" info, it's 32 bit.
